How Neck Pain Can Lead to Nerve Damage

Neck pain affects people worldwide, ranging from minor discomfort to debilitating conditions that interfere with daily activities. While many cases of this pain stem from muscle strain or poor posture, some instances involve neurological complications that may result in nerve damage. Understanding the connection between neck pain and potential nerve damage can help individuals recognize when to seek medical attention.

What Causes Neck Pain?

Several conditions can create circumstances where neck pain and nerve damage occur together. These conditions affect the cervical spine’s structure and function, potentially impacting nerve pathways. Prominent conditions include:

  • Herniated Discs: Cervical disc herniation occurs when the soft inner material of a spinal disc pushes through its outer layer. This displaced material may press against nearby nerve roots, causing both pain and nerve-related symptoms.
  • Cervical Stenosis: Spinal stenosis involves the narrowing of spaces within the spine, which can compress nerve structures. The reduced space available for nerves may lead to pain and neurological symptoms.
  • Degenerative Changes: Age-related wear and tear affect the cervical spine’s discs, joints, and surrounding structures. These degenerative changes can alter the spine’s alignment and create conditions where nerve compression becomes more likely.
  • Traumatic Injuries: Whiplash injuries may create immediate or delayed effects on nerve pathways. The extent of nerve involvement often depends on the severity and location of the injury.

How Is It Diagnosed?

Diagnosing the cause of neck pain requires a comprehensive evaluation that combines clinical examination with advanced imaging techniques. Healthcare providers use multiple approaches to identify the source of symptoms and assess potential nerve involvement. The diagnostic process typically begins with a detailed medical history and physical examination. 

Imaging Studies

Mag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) provides detailed images of soft tissues, including the spinal cord, nerve roots, and intervertebral discs. This imaging technique can reveal herniated discs, spinal stenosis, or other structural abnormalities that may cause nerve compression. Computed tomography (CT) scans offer excellent visualization of bone structures and may identify bone spurs, fractures, or instability that might contribute to neurological symptoms.

Electrodiagnostic Testing

Nerve conduction studies and electromyography (EMG) can assess the function of peripheral nerves and muscles. These tests help determine whether nerve damage has occurred and may provide information about the severity and location of the problem. Electrodiagnostic testing proves particularly valuable when providers need to assess the extent of nerve damage objectively.

How Is It Treated?

Treatment approaches for the cause of neck pain vary depending on the specific condition, severity of symptoms, and extent of nerve involvement. Most treatment plans begin with conservative measures before progressing to more invasive interventions. Non-surgical treatments form the foundation of care for many neurological neck conditions. Physical therapy can help improve neck mobility, strengthen supporting muscles, and reduce pressure on nerve structures.

Medications may include anti-inflammatory drugs to reduce swelling around compressed nerves and nerve blocks for nerve-related discomfort. In some cases, epidural steroid injections may provide targeted anti-inflammatory treatment near affected nerve roots. When conservative treatments fail to provide relief or when progressive neurological deficits develop, surgical options may be recommended.
